2008 Chrysler Grand Voyager vs. 2004 Lamborghini Gallardo

To start off, 2008 Chrysler Grand Voyager is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2004 Lamborghini Gallardo.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2004 Lamborghini Gallardo would be higher. At 4,959 cc (10 cylinders), 2004 Lamborghini Gallardo is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2004 Lamborghini Gallardo (500 HP @ 7800 RPM) has 325 more horse power than 2008 Chrysler Grand Voyager. (175 HP @ 5100 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2004 Lamborghini Gallardo should accelerate faster than 2008 Chrysler Grand Voyager.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Chrysler Grand Voyager weights approximately 625 kg more than 2004 Lamborghini Gallardo.

Because 2004 Lamborghini Gallardo is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2008 Chrysler Grand Voyager.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2004 Lamborghini Gallardo will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2004 Lamborghini Gallardo (500 Nm) has 222 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Chrysler Grand Voyager. (278 Nm). This means 2004 Lamborghini Gallardo will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Chrysler Grand Voyager.

Compare all specifications:

2008 Chrysler Grand Voyager 2004 Lamborghini Gallardo
Make Chrysler Lamborghini
Model Grand Voyager Gallardo
Year Released 2008 2004
Body Type Minivan Coupe
Engine Position Front Middle
Engine Size 3301 cc 4959 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 10 cylinders
Engine Type V V
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 175 HP 500 HP
Engine RPM 5100 RPM 7800 RPM
Torque 278 Nm 500 Nm
Engine Bore Size 93 mm 83 mm
Engine Stroke Size 81 mm 93 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 9.3:1 11.0:1
Drive Type Front 4WD
Number of Seats 7 seats 2 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 2055 kg 1430 kg
Vehicle Length 4930 mm 4310 mm
Vehicle Height 1490 mm 1170 mm
Wheelbase Size 3040 mm 2560 mm
Fuel Consumption Overall 11.3 L/100km 21.4 L/100km
Fuel Tank Capacity 75 L 90 L
